coordinated

Aussprache: [koʊˈɔrdɪˌneɪtɪd]

Wort

Kontext: „similarity“

(adjective) when things are arranged or functioning in a synchronized or organized manner. If different activities or parts of a plan work well together, they are coordinated.

Beispiel

The coordinated dance performance impressed everyone in the audience.

Beispiel

His movements were not coordinated, and he stumbled during the routine.

Beispiel

How can we make sure our team’s efforts are more coordinated?

Kontext: „organization“

(verb) to arrange or manage different parts so they work well together. This is like when someone organizes a project so that everyone knows what to do and when.

Beispiel

She coordinated the event smoothly, ensuring that all tasks were completed on time.

Beispiel

He did not coordinate the activities well, and many things were forgotten.

Beispiel

Have you ever coordinated a project with multiple people involved?
